Cops find diamond-studded sex toy with hidden drugs, gemstones

Four men were arrested in Amstelveen on Friday when police found five bags of cannabis and a block of cocaine hidden in secret compartments of two vehicles. Along with the drugs, police seized nearly 40,000 euros, 1,700 British pounds, 1,200 Swiss francs, 14 gemstones, five gold coins, a smaller quantity of cannabis, and a sex-toy with inlaid diamonds.

It all started when a police officer on his own personal time witnessed what looked like a "suspicious transaction" between the occupants of two vehicles. The astute cop requested back-up, bringing more officers to the Groenhof Mall at the outskirts of the town southwest of Amsterdam.

Police arrested the four men and proceeded to search the two vehicles, a Mercedes and a Porsche. They include a 36-year-old Amsterdammer, a 51-year-old from Uithoorn, a 35-year-old from Turkey, and a German man, 41.
